Syncro single cab 1990 1.9TD for sale(now with photos)

Post by Russel »

Low milage 1.9TD(intercooled)fitted 2.5 months ago.New clutch,timing belt and tensioner.Fully serviced.5 almost new 205 80 16 atacama greenway tyres.2 spare wheel carriers.30mm lift kit fitted.
Custom cage on load bed and custom air snorkle.
Cab is sound dedened.Seats 3 with 3 3point seat belts.(yes 3)
CD player,revcounter,boost guage, volt meter guage.
Body could do with respray but very solid.Chassi rust treated and resealed.
Above average condition load bed.
50l second feul tank.Needs heated filter to run bio diesle.
Long MOT and 3months tax
£ 2650 ono
